Consignments are to be free from pests, soil, weed seeds and extraneous material.


Original and certified translation of the import permit must be presented to the Authorised Officer at the time of inspection.


Where applicable, the exporter is to provide evidence attesting to the endorsement and present it to the Authorised Officer at the time of inspection.


Explanation of the endorsement

Endorsement 6642:

  • Nematodes (Longidorus spp, Meloidogyne spp, Paratrichodorus spp, Pratylenchus spp, Trichodorus spp, Radopholus similis) are not on seed export pathway for Brassica oleracea var. italica. No evidence is required to endorse freedom from these pests.
  • Visual inspection by an Authorised Officer is sufficient for endorsing freedom from Sandbar (Cenchrus spp), Garden snail (Helix aspersa), Darnel grass (Lolium temulentum) and White garden snail (Theba pisana).
  • A laboratory analysis certificate, crop inspection certificate or an area freedom certificate is required for endorsing freedom from Bacterial leaf blight (Pseudomonas syringae pv. maculicola) and Blackleg (Leptosphaeria maculans).
Nil Endorsement:
  • If no additional declaration requirements are stated on the import permit, a phytosanitary certificate with no additional declaration is to be issued.

Option 1 (EXDOC Endorsement 6642)
1) The consignment was found free through official testing and inspection procedure of Free living nematodes (Trichodorus spp), White garden snail (Theba pisana), Root lesion nematodes (Pratylenchus spp), Bacterial leaf blight (Pseudomonas syringae pv. maculicola), Darnel grass (Lolium temulentum), Sandbar (Cenchrus spp), Nematode (Meloidogyne spp), Needle nematodes (Longidorus spp), Burrowing nematode (Radopholus similis), Sturdy root nematode (Paratrichodorus spp), Garden snail (Helix aspersa), and Blackleg (Leptosphaeria maculans).
